Local pianist performs holiday favorites tonight

Local pianist, Tom Baroco, presents his first public appearance, “Tom Baroco on Piano: The Christmas Concert,”which will feature a heartwarming arrangement of holiday music favorites. The concert will take place at the Pensacola Little Theater on tonight at 7:30 pm. Tickets are $10 each and can be purchased through the Pensacola Little Theater.

Also performing will be guest artists Mary Anne Lane on the violin, Emily Berry on the flute and local musical group Mass Confuzion, formed by

Angela Baroco, Dave Clark, Steve Hernandez, Brian LeBlanc and Mark Whibbs. The concert will be comprised of instrumental piano, festive vocals and spirit-lifting band numbers.

Proceeds will benefit the charitable works of Catholic Charities of Northwest Florida. The event is sponsored by Dollarhide’s Music and Sound and the Pensacola Little Theater.

Baroco’s benefit concert coincides with the release of his holiday CD, “Christmas

Blessings,” a collection of holiday piano arrangements. It is an hour-long CD that reflects a mix of religious and secular pieces, including his own composition, Blessings. Also on the CD are the seldom-heard Gregorian Chants Of the Father’s Love Begotten and Creator of the Stars of Night.
